    June 25th 1996 Jay Z released his first hip-hop album. The album changed the game! Fast forward 20 years later and he's the king of hip-hop. What's Higher than number one?
    Today Jay's streaming service TIDAL released RD 20, a 35-minute documentary directed by Scheme Engine about Jay's come-up, the album's creation, and its legacy today.

Major Moves: Jay-Z & Roc Nation Partners With Universal Music Group

Major Moves: Jay-Z & Roc Nation Partners With Universal Music Group

04/08/2013  |  No Comments

04/08/2013

    Via prnewswire.com
    Universal Music Group (UMG),the world's leading music company, and Roc Nation, the renowned entertainment company founded by Shawn "JAY Z" Carter, announced today that they have entered into a multi-year, worldwide partnership under which the Roc Nation music label will operate as a standalone label within the UMG family, effective immediately.Financial terms of the deal were not disclosed.As part of the agreement, forthcoming albums from JAY Z, Rihanna and many others will be released through UMG worldwide.
    In making the announcement, Lucian Grainge, Chairman and CEO ofUMG, said,"In just five years, Roc Nation has established itself as one of the most successful brands in music with a reputation for developing some of today¹s most influential and popular talent.Not only does this agreement provide a dynamic platform for Roc Nation's exciting emerging artists, it extends our relationship with the extraordinary Rihanna and represents a homecoming for JAY Z—a brilliant artist and entrepreneur, who has been a creative cornerstone of our company.All of us at UMG are thrilled that JAY and Roc Nation chose UMG as their partners, knowing we will support their artists with a level of resources, expertise and passion that is simply unmatched in the industry."
    Shawn "JAY Z" Carter said, "We are looking forward to working with Lucian and the incredible team he's assembled at Universal. We would like to applaud Lucian for collaborating with us to strike a new age deal. This agreement presents a unique opportunity for Roc Nation's artists—being able to continue to operate as an independent label with the strength, power and reach of the best major. I look forward to a long and prosperous collaboration with UMG. It feels good to be home."

Roc-A-Fella Records Co-Founder Kareem “Biggs” Burke Pleads Guilty To Federal Drug Charges

Roc-A-Fella Records Co-Founder Kareem “Biggs” Burke Pleads Guilty To Federal Drug Charges

03/16/2012  |  No Comments

03/16/2012 Damnnnnn....smh!! How did this happen? You see the title of this post right? "Co-Founder"of Roc-A-Fella but yet I am posting about how he caught federal drug charges?!? Yesterday Kareem “Biggs” Burke appeared in court and admitted to his federal drug charges including conspiracy and intent to distribute over 100 kilograms of Marijuana. As part of the plea deal, “Biggs” forfeited $660k, $15k seized cash, his 2010 BMW and home. As part of an 18-month investigation, Biggs’ New Bergen, NJ home was raided in October 2010 and was among the 50 individuals arrested for their drug trafficking operation that stretched from Florida to New York.
